引言
在使用V2Ray的过程中,用户可能会遇到各种错误信息,其中之一就是 v2ray.com/core/app/proxyman/outbound: failed to process outbound traffic
。这个错误通常表示V2Ray在处理出站流量时发生了问题。理解这个错误的原因以及如何解决它,对于保证网络的正常使用至关重要。
什么是V2Ray?
V2Ray是一个流量转发工具,广泛用于翻墙和隐私保护。它支持多种协议,并能够灵活地配置出站流量和入站流量,适用于不同的网络环境。
proxyman组件简介
V2Ray中的proxyman组件主要负责管理流量的出站和入站。这一组件的主要功能包括:
- 流量管理:监控和转发流量。
- 协议支持:支持多种传输协议。
- 错误处理:在遇到问题时进行错误反馈和处理。
出站流量失败的常见原因
- 配置错误:V2Ray的配置文件中的参数设置不正确,导致出站流量无法正常转发。
- 网络问题:本地网络连接不稳定,可能会导致流量无法发送。
- 代理服务器问题:所连接的代理服务器出现故障或宕机。
- 权限问题:V2Ray可能没有足够的权限来处理流量。
解决方法
1. 检查配置文件
- 确保配置文件的格式正确,特别是出站部分的设置。
- 核对代理服务器的地址和端口是否正确。
- 使用在线工具检查JSON格式的合法性。
2. 测试网络连接
- 尝试访问其他网站,确认网络是否正常。
- 使用ping命令检查与代理服务器的连接。
3. 更新V2Ray版本
- 确保使用的是最新版本的V2Ray,开发者可能已经修复了相关的bug。
- 使用命令行更新工具进行更新。
4. 权限设置
- 确认V2Ray运行的用户具有必要的网络权限。
- 如果在Linux系统中,确保服务以适当的权限运行。
FAQ
什么是V2Ray的出站流量?
出站流量是指V2Ray发送出去的数据包,包括向外部服务器请求资源时的数据。配置出站流量时,需要指定目标服务器及相应的协议。
如何检查V2Ray的配置是否正确?
可以使用命令行工具来验证配置文件的语法和格式。V2Ray本身也提供了一些调试工具,用于检查配置的有效性。
遇到此错误时,如何收集日志信息?
在V2Ray配置中,可以设置日志级别。修改配置文件中的 log
字段,设置为 debug
级别,重新启动V2Ray后,查看日志文件获取详细的错误信息。
是否需要重启V2Ray?
如果修改了配置文件或进行了版本更新,建议重启V2Ray,以确保新的设置生效。
结论
遇到 v2ray.com/core/app/proxyman/outbound: failed to process outbound traffic
错误时,首先不要慌张,逐步排查配置和网络问题。通过上述方法和步骤,绝大多数用户都能够成功解决该问题,从而顺利使用V2Ray。如果问题仍然存在,建议在相关社区寻求进一步的支持。
正文完